While both types of insurance provide a safety net for homeowners, they serve different purposes. Life insurance typically pays out a lump sum to beneficiaries upon the policyholder's passing, whereas mortgage protection insurance focuses specifically on covering mortgage payments.

The US housing market has experienced significant growth in recent years, with many Americans buying homes and investing in real estate. However, this growth has also led to increased financial stress for homeowners. The threat of job loss, medical emergencies, or other unforeseen events can put a homeowner's financial security at risk. Insurance for mortgage protection offers a solution by covering mortgage payments in the event of an unexpected event.

Insurance for mortgage protection is a type of life insurance or disability insurance that specifically covers mortgage payments. It works by paying out a lump sum or monthly benefit in the event of an insured event, such as the policyholder's death or disability. This ensures that the homeowner can continue making mortgage payments, even if they are no longer able to do so themselves. The benefit is usually tax-free, and the policy can be tailored to the individual's needs.
